 How much does the optional FMF powercore silencer help out?

to be honest. not much.
does change it a bit, and I will say that it is a lil quieter at idle.
above idle not much change if any and at WFO no change to my ears.

the only difference is about 3 inches of tubing around the spark arrestor.

The megabomb header will reduce the sound output as well, which is why I ran it with the powercore (and tried to sell both together). The powerbomb header likely helps with sound too, just not as much as the megabomb. Try the silencer first too. Worst case swapping back to stock doesn't take very long when its time to get inspected. So happy MD doesn't inspect except at time of sale...
